The International Group Art Exhibition "Kaleidoscope: Small Worlds" in collaboration with Art Mozaik Fine Art Gallery (713 Canyon Road, Santa Fe, NM 87501, USA) and JS Gallery, opens on September 2, 2025. Curator: Julia Sysalova | Assistant Curator: Oxana Akopov

SANTA FE, N.M. - Marylandian -- How much can fit into a small space? A memory, a sensation, a landscape of the soul. Kaleidoscope: Small Worlds brings together 35 emerging artists from 16 countries — including the USA, United Kingdom, Germany, France, Spain, Netherlands, Greece, Finland, Russia, Armenia, Kazakhstan, Latvia, Kyrgyzstan, Cyprus, Czech Republic, and New Zealand — each offering a personal fragment of a wider mosaic.

The exhibition invites visitors to see the world through a more thoughtful and intimate lens. Small and medium formats become a way to speak of universal themes: personal and cultural memory, sensations, inner landscapes, identity, belonging, and the subtle vibrations of time and space. Working in painting, collage, photography, and mixed media, the participating artists compose a visual polyphony — a shared rhythm born of difference.

"Each fragment holds a world, a story, a bridge between cultures," says curator Julia Sysalova. "This global project unites artists, showing how small works can form a powerful, collective artistic statement."

Participating artists: Oxana Akopov (USA), Alina Altukhova (USA), Veronika Arto (Germany), Asia Aveli (Kyrgyzstan), Gala Bushido (France), Patricia Demba (Greece), Consonance Ebb (USA), Svetlana Fenster (Cyprus), Julia Flit (UK), Natasha Freeman (Russia), Anastasia Gofman (USA), Svetlana Hants (USA), Olga Horne (New Zealand), Olga Ivkin (USA), Alana Joy (USA), Casey Kallos (USA), Elmira Kandy (Kazakhstan), Nina Kruser (Germany), Elena Kuki (USA), Ksenia Mazheyko (Spain), Irina Metz (Armenia), Kseniia Nelasova (USA), Veronika Obushikhina (Spain), Alina Obukhova (USA), Nataliia Ovcharova (USA), Lana Reiber (USA), Alena Rezanova (USA), Anastasiia Romanova (Czech Republic), Veera Romanoff (Finland), Regina Sultanova (USA), Larisa Travina & Anton Mashanov (USA), Vic Tur (USA), Inna Voronov (USA), Yuliyu Zadorozhnyuk (Ukraine/Netherlands), Dina Zakmane (Latvia).
  • Soft Opening: Tuesday, September 2, 5–7 pm MDT
  • Reception: Friday, September 12, 5–7 pm MDT
  • Duration: September 2–30, 2025
  • Venue: Art Mozaik Fine Art Gallery, 713 Canyon Road, Santa Fe, NM 87501, USA
  • Hours: Mon–Sat: 10 am–6 pm; Sun: 11 am–6 pm

Julia Sysalova (Greece) is an Athens-based curator, critic, and art communication educator. She serves as Vice President at the Institute of Mediterranean Culture, is a member of AICA, and founded the Art Communication Online School in 2022.

AboutArt Mozaik Fine Art Gallery:

On Santa Fe's iconic Canyon Road, Art Mozaik has been a leading contemporary art venue for five years. A 2024 "Best Gallery" finalist, it champions emotionally resonant art, inclusion, and cultural exchange under its motto: "Surround Yourself with Art that is filled with Happiness."

About JS Gallery:

Part of the Institute of Mediterranean Culture (Greece), JS Gallery promotes creativity, diversity, and cross-cultural dialogue through international art projects.
